Greetings! UK supermarkets are home to a multitude of unique and sometimes worrisome food items which include but are not limited to:

Fridge Raiders - "Our deliciously meaty Fridge Raiders come in bags, full of irresistible flavours" ... they are chunks of chicken in a bag. Surprisingly tasty.
Innocent Veg Pot - assorted vegetarian meals in resealable plastic pots. But if the vegetables are innocent too ...
And of course,
Muller Yogurt Corner - The most delicious thing you've ever had.

That final item happens to make up 80% of my fridge contents, by unit (the other two items are a bottle of wine and a single bottle of beer). Be proud! I'm eating healthy!

As promised, I will give the low-down on my flat. It's university accommodations, and it looks it. Very residence-y: tiny boxy rooms and generic functional sort of furniture. But I quite like it. It's very bright, so far quite warm, and it's also pretty quiet (no friends is handy for that) except at night since the window must be plastic wrap or something and I can here the frosh being froshy on the street. But that's what earplugs are for. Wilma took me round to IKEA and set me up with a bright magenta sheet set and some other things I needed (dishes, etc) so now it's looking much less like a hospital. The shower is electric heated so always warm, and I've got my own radiator and controls in my bedroom. Best of all, there's a wine shop two doors down. Happy days! (to quote Wilma)

Flatmates seem nice. One girl is from Japan and so far completely invisible. Another is Scottish and I have now spoken to her on three one-minute occassions. And the last is from the states and probably very nice. Scotland is the only fresher, the rest are on exchange like me.
